Goutorbe-Bouillot Clos des Monnaies 2010 Champagne 75cl
The tiny 0.28-hectare walled vineyard of Clos des Monnaies was planted in 1930 by Jules Goutorbe and takes its name from Roman coins discovered on the site.  Planted to equal parts Chardonnay and Pinot Meunier, the wine is fermented and matured in old oak barrels before spending over 50 months on its lees and a further year in bottle prior to release. With just over 1,000 bottles produced, the outstanding 2010 vintage combines impressive richness and depth with the freshness and tension that define the House style.  Now with more than 15 years of maturity, it has developed beautifully, offering layers of complexity while retaining remarkable energy and precision.
